分享代码HTML5的实现方法通常涉及到调用第三方应用的SDK,如微信等,并跳转至自己部署在服务器上的H5页面。这一过程中,如果需要传递参数,可以通过URL进行传输。
在实际操作时,首先需要在APP内集成第三方SDK。以微信分享为例,开发者需要获取微信的AppID和AppSecret,并在APP内配置相应的参数。接着,通过调用SDK提供的分享接口,实现分享操作。在接口调用时,可以携带需要分享的内容和参数,这些参数将通过URL传递给服务器端。
当用户点击分享按钮时,APP会触发SDK的分享事件。SDK会自动构造一个包含分享内容、参数以及第三方应用的跳转链接的URL。这个URL随后被APP发送到服务器,服务器接收到URL后,解析出其中的分享信息和参数,然后构建相应的H5页面内容并返回给客户端。
在H5页面中,开发者需要准备一个接收并处理分享参数的逻辑。这通常包括解析URL中的参数,然后根据这些参数来调整页面的内容和布局,以适应不同的分享场景。例如,如果分享的是文章内容,页面可能会显示文章标题、摘要和图片等元素;如果是产品推广,页面可能会展示产品图片、价格和购买链接等。
在页面加载完成并准备好展示内容后,SDK会将页面渲染到屏幕上,并允许用户进行进一步的交互,如点赞、评论或直接访问链接。这个过程在不同平台(如iOS、Android和网页版)上可能会有所不同,但核心逻辑大致相同,即通过URL传递参数,并在H5页面上展示和处理这些参数。
总的来说,实现APP上的代码分享HTML5功能,关键在于集成第三方SDK、处理URL中的参数,并在H5页面上构建相应的展示逻辑。这一过程需要开发者具备一定的前端和后端技术,以及对第三方服务的集成能力。
温馨提示:答案为网友推荐,仅供参考